IT should be 6 or 5 pm in california == New York is in the Eastern Zone, California is in the Pacific zone. Between them are the Central and Mountain zones. Each zone moving west is one hour earier than the previous. For instance: if it is 8:00 pm in New York, it is 7:00 pm in the Central zone, 6:00 pm in the Mountain zone, and 5:00 pm in Sacramento, California in the Pacific zone.

California is behind New York City in terms of time. California is in the Pacific Time Zone, while New York City is in the Eastern Time Zone. This means that California is usually 3 hours behind New York City.
New Mexico: Mountain Time New York: Eastern Time There is a time difference of two hours between New Mexico and New York. If it is 1:00 pm in New Mexico, it is 3:00 pm in New York.
New York is ahead of California by 3 hours, so if it is 7 pm in California, then it will be 10 pm in New York.
